Tullytown, a community in Bucks County, Pennsylvania, has 2,367 residents. Its median household income of $71,118 runs below the Bucks County figure of $111,951.
From 2019 to 2023, Tullytown's population grew 9.1% from 2,169 to 2,367, while its median home value rose 33.8% from $239,500 to $320,500.
58.3% of homes are single-family detached houses. The typical home was built around 1957.
